Banjarmasin, South Kalimantan (Antaranews) - steel processing industry in districts Kotabaru targeted to begin operating around 2016.

"Hopefully there are no barriers to the end of 2016, it will be operating," said President Director of PT Sebuku Iron Lateritic Ores (SILO), Efendi Tios, while attending the inauguration of and 'groundbreaking' of Masterplan projects for the Acceleration and Expansion of Indonesian Economic Development (MP3EI) by Indonesian President Susilo Bambang Yudhoyono, in Banjarbaru on Wednesday.

Currently, PT SILO has completed construction of an integrated steel industry phase I (Industrial cleaning iron ore) in Sebuku Island, Kotabaru, valued at Rp1,200 trillion. He explained that the next phase will begin in 2014, and so on.

Meanwhile, in addition to building a steel processing industry, PT SILO Group is also building other supporting facilities, such as, coke plant using coal as fuel for iron ore processing and other infrastructure facilities.

Supporting its productivity and raw materials of the steel industry, PT SILO Group already has a number of iron ore and coal mining companies.

Among of hem, the coal company PT Sebuku Batubai Coal covering 9691.97 hectares in the subdistrict of North Pulau Laut and the Central Pulau Laut, PT Sebuku Tanjung with an area of 9898.61 hectares with a potential just around 1814.10 hectares or about 18.3 percent.

PT Sebuku Sejakah Coal with an area of about 25 thousand ha with a potentially just around 1534.20 hectares or about 6.14 percent. Iron ore mining company PT Banjar Asri in subdistrict of East Pulau Laut and the Central Pulau Laut with an area of approximately 1,395 hectares, and land potentially just around 625.5 or approximately 44.84 per cent .
